Seattle caused the biggest uproar during draft night by taking a guy who was projected to be a 3rd round pick, in the high 1st round.

after the draft, some people called Bruce Irvin a Von Miller clone, and other said that he was a wasted 1st round pick.

Who knows how the season is going to turn out, but keep going the way they are, Irvin is on pace to get double digit sacks in his rookie season.
